    Why Vitamin E Is a Miracle Ingredient for Chapped Lips

    By Virat VermaNovember 15, 2025
    Facebook Twitter WhatsApp Email
    Why Vitamin E Is a Miracle Ingredient for Chapped Lips

    Whether it’s due to lack of moisture or dryness, chapped lips trouble almost everyone. Sometimes, no matter how many products we apply, the lips remain dry and cracked. In such cases, Vitamin E can work very effectively to heal chapped lips. You might be wondering whether you need to apply Vitamin E directly on your lips—the answer is no. You just need to follow a few simple tips to use it correctly. So, let’s learn how to use Vitamin E for chapped lips.

    How to Use Vitamin E for Chapped Lips

    For treating chapped lips, mix Vitamin E with shea butter. Here’s how to use it:

    • Take a small container and add some shea butter.
    • Add the oil from 1 or 2 Vitamin E capsules into it.
    • Mix both ingredients well.
    • Apply this mixture on your lips and massage gently.
    • Leave it as it is.
    • Apply it at least three times a day, and if not, then make sure to apply it before sleeping at night.

    This is highly beneficial for healing dry and cracked lips.

    Benefits of Vitamin E for Chapped Lips

    Vitamin E works very effectively for dry and damaged lips. It hydrates the skin of the lips and improves blood circulation. It also helps repair damaged skin and improves the texture of the lips. Over time, it enhances the softness and tone of the lips, making them healthy and smooth.

    Skin Benefits of Applying Vitamin E

    Not just on the lips, Vitamin E can also be used on the skin. Applying Vitamin E oil regularly on the face helps keep the skin moisturized, reduces fine lines and wrinkles, lightens dark spots, and adds natural glow. As a powerful antioxidant, it protects the skin from sun damage and pollution, and also helps maintain the skin’s elasticity.
